Evaluating the Cabinet's Problem



When starting the restoration process, start by evaluating the problem of the antique cupboard. Very carefully analyze the total structure for any kind of indications of damage such as splits, chips, or loosened joints. Implementing the Reconstruction Process



To effectively implement the remediation process on your antique closet, begin by thoroughly cleaning the surface with the wood cleaner. This action is important as it helps eliminate years of dust, gunk, and old polish that may have collected externally.

As soon as the cabinet is clean and completely dry, examine the problem of the timber. Search for any kind of splits, scrapes, or other damages that require to be dealt with. Use timber filler to fix any type of flaws, seeing to it to match the filler shade to the wood tone for a seamless surface.



After the fixings have actually dried, delicately sand the entire surface area to develop a smooth and also base for the new coating. Be careful not to sand as well strongly, as you don't intend to damage the timber below.

As soon as the sanding is full, use a timber discolor or finish of your option, complying with the maker's guidelines. Permit the finish to dry entirely prior to using a protective leading coat to make certain the durability of your restored antique closet.
